General Info
In Block
e4869b1c6385c675a3c1af0060cdece032957126ae7a8409b4f901f5cd9170b3
In block height
Total Input
21722.03285292 RDD
Total Output
21721.03285292 RDD
Transaction Details
Fee
1 RDD
mined Wed, 11 Apr 2018 09:24:38 UTC
From
14999.5 RDDFrom
6675.16637852 RDDFrom
47.3664744 RDD